I've tried following these steps for a factory reset but I do not know how you're supposed to continually hold down the side button (in the cradle with the cut out hole for pressing the button) AND be able to continue to hold it down when you remove the watch from the cable. You must let go of the button to get it out of the cradle. Can someone clarify Step 2, transition to Step 3?
To factory reset your tracker:
- Attach the charging cable to your tracker and plug the other end into a USB port.
- Press and hold the button for approximately two seconds and without letting go of the button:
- Remove the charging cable from your tracker.
- Wait about seven to nine more seconds after removing the charging cable.
- Let go of the button and hold it down again.
- After "ALT" and a white screen flash, let go of the button and hold it down again.
- After you feel a vibration, let go of the button and hold it down again.
- After you see "ERROR," let go of the button and hold it down again.

Hey there @DDNGA, thanks for stopping by! While reading your post I was wondering where you got those steps from? It seems those steps belong to a Factory Reset for Fitbit Charge and Charge HR, not the Charge 3. You can see in this article.
If you want to perform a Factory Reset on Charge 3, see: How do I erase my Fitbit device?
If your Fitbit device has one of the following problems, it may be fixed by a restart:
- Not syncing
- Not responding to button presses, taps, or swipes
- Charged but doesn't turn on
- Not tracking your steps or other stats
Restarting your device turns it off and on without deleting any activity data (like the Factory Reset does). If your device saves notifications, a restart deletes them.
Follow the restart instructions below.
- Plug the charging cable into the USB port on your computer or any UL-certified USB wall charger.
- Clip the other end of the charging cable to the port on the back of the tracker. The pins on the charging cable must lock securely with the port.
- Make sure the button on your tracker is aligned with the button opening on the charging cable. You’ll know the connection is secure when the tracker vibrates and you see a battery icon on your tracker’s display.
- Press and hold the button on your tracker for 8 seconds. Release the button. When you see a smile icon and the tracker vibrates, the tracker restarted.
- Unplug your tracker from the charging cable.
